In the spirit of Oriental Medicine, a primary goal of Mariryan Heschmeyer, D.O.M. is to provide her patients with a broader understanding of health and more lasting sense of well-being. Instead of the traditional disease-centered focus of conventional medicine, TCM applies a patient-centered approach that addresses the whole person rather than simply his symptoms. We combine the discipline of modern science with the wisdom of ancient healing and take advantage of the knowledge of several disciplines. What this means is that patient and provider work together to develop an integrated diagnostic and therapeutic plan that will best address the whole patient. Mariryan Heschmeyer graduated from the University of Florida with a Bachelors of Science in 2000. She continued her education at Dragon Rises College of Oriental Medicine, graduating in the top of her class in 2005 receiving a Doctorate in Oriental Medicine, D.O.M. She accepted an appointment in Atlanta shortly after graduating to treat top professional athletes in the area. Mariryan is nationally board certified in Acupuncture, Chinese Herbology and Biomedicine. Her practice emphasizes in Family medicine while specializing in infertility, helping more than 120 women conceive while also managing them succesfully throughout their pregnancy. She has a successful practice in Albany, GA and has recently opened, in both Venice and St. Petersburg.

I take my patients off of Tumeric all the time.

Although tumeric (active ingredient curcumin) is great at reducing inflammation it needs to be BALANCED. The herb itself is HOT in nature (yang) and when not balanced it sets off a series of negative events in the body.
Good news is, TCM has known this for 1000s of years and there are balanced herbal prescriptions with curcumin in them. 👏

Katie Mohan started taking daily turmeric pills in March after seeing a doctor on Instagram tout its benefits for inflammation and joint pain relief. A few weeks later, the 57-year-old started having stomach pain, nausea and fatigue.

“I just did not feel well generally,” she said. “I also noticed that despite drinking a lot of water every day, that my urine was darker.”

Mohan didn’t link her symptoms to the herbal pills until she saw an NBC News report in May about rising liver damage from supplements. She recognized her symptoms in a patient taking the same high dose of turmeric.

Within a week, Mohan went to urgent care, where tests showed her liver enzymes were 70 times the normal level.

“It was very serious,” said Dr. Nikolaos Pyrsopoulos, a hepatologist at NYU. “Katie actually was one step before full liver damage, liver failure, requiring liver transplant.”
